Matcha Almond Pudding(¥390)😋
Delighting my taste buds with a wobbly pudding infused with a strong almond taste, generously coated with a thick and luscious matcha sauce. The combination of the nutty almond flavour and the bittersweet matcha created a harmonious and enjoyable dessert to cleanse the palate after a satisfying ramen feast.

Ichiran Ramen(¥980) + Half-boiled Egg(¥140)🍜🥚
Embarking on the iconic Ichiran Ramen experience.😂 I opted for the dashi medium broth, rich richness, 1 clove of garlic, and medium spiciness. The bowl arrived with a flavourful, creamy, and milky broth that perfectly satisfied my cravings. The richness level was just right, but next time I might go for extra richness to take it up a notch. The medium spiciness added a delightful kick to the broth, enhancing its savoury profile. The tender and succulent cha siu slices were a treat, and the garlickiness provided a pleasant burst of flavour, although I wished for a bit more garlic (extra charge, sigh). The half-boiled egg was perfectly cooked with a gooey yolk. Overall, a tastisfying bowl of ramen to conclude the day.
